Description
The semantics distributed over large-scale knowledge bases can be used to intermediate heterogeneous users' activity logs created in services; such information can be used to improve applications that can help users to decide the next activities/services. Since user activities can be represented in terms of relationships involving three or more things (e. g. a user tags movie items on a webpage), tensors are an attractive approach to represent them. The recently introduced Semantic Sensitive Tensor Factorization (SSTF) is promising as it achieves high accuracy in predicting users' activities by basing tensor factorization on the semantics behind objects (e. g. item categories). However, SSTF currently focuses on the factorization of a tensor for a single service and thus has two problems: (1) the balance problem occurs when handling heterogeneous datasets simultaneously, and (2)the sparsity problem triggered by insufficient observations within a single service. Our solution, Semantic Sensitive Simultaneous Tensor Factorization (S3TF), tackles the problems by: (1) Creating tensors for individual services and factorizing them simultaneously; it does not force the creation of a tensor from multiple services and factorize the single tensor. This avoids the low prediction accuracy caused by the balance problem. (2) Utilizing shared semantics behind distributed activity logs and assigning semantic bias to each tensor factorization. This avoids the sparsity problem by sharing semantics among services. Experiments using real-world datasets show that S3TF achieves higher accuracy in rating prediction than the current best tensor method. It also extracts implicit relationships across services in the feature spaces by simultaneous factorization with shared semantics.
